Knowledge Base - About the company

Knowledge Base is a funded company based in Boston (United States), founded in 1998 by Jedrzej Bogack. It operates as a Cloud and AI based knowledge management software for customer service. Knowledge Base has raised an undisclosed amount in funding. The company has 163 active competitors, including 32 funded and 19 that have exited. Its top competitors include companies like Bloomfire, Guru and Inbenta.

Company Details

Cloud and AI based knowledge management software for customer service. It provides customer support and self service software, allowing users to create articles, titles, and keywords. Some of the features of the platform include knowledge visualization, reporting, live chat integration, and more.
